Fig. 1Bone marrow morphologic characteristics of the patient, next-generation sequencing data visualization using Integrative Genomics Viewer, and Sanger sequencing results revealing two RAB27A variants. (A, B) Hemophagocytes with ingested granulocytes (A) and multiple ingested nucleated red blood cells and erythroid progenitors (B) on the bone marrow aspirate smears (Wright-Giemsa stain, ×1,000). (C, D) Sequences of the RAB27A gene showing two splice site variants, c.467+5G>A (C) and c.343+2T>C (D). (E) Sanger sequencing chromatograms of the two RAB27A variants in the patient and his parents.
Genetic and clinical characteristics of patients with RAB27A variants
| Variant | Protein change | Inheritance | HLH | Partial albinism | Reference |
|---|---|---|---|---|---|
| c.467+5G >A | Splice site | Homozygous | No | Yes | [ |
| c.65A >G | Lys22Arg | Homozygous | Yes | Yes | [ |
| c.227C >T | Ala76Val Tyr159Cys | Compound heterozygous | Yes | No | [ |
| c.400_401delAA | Lys134Glufs | Compound heterozygous | Yes | No | [ |
| c.428T >C | Val143Ala | Homozygous | Yes | No | [ |
| c.422-424delGAG | Arg141-Val142delinsIle | Homozygous | Yes | No | [ |
| c.422-424delGAG | Arg141-Val142delinsIle | Compound heterozygous | Yes | No | [ |
| c.422-424delGAG | Arg141-Val142delinsIle | Compound heterozygous | Yes | No | [ |
| 5’ UTR dup/inv | Structural variant | Homozygous | Yes | No | [ |
| 5’ UTR dup/inv/del | Structural variant Arg187Trp | Compound heterozygous | Yes | No | [ |
| 5’ UTR dup/inv/del | Structural variant Arg80Thr | Compound heterozygous | Yes | No | [ |
| 5’ UTR dup/inv | Structural variant Arg184 | Compound heterozygous | Yes | No | [ |
| c.53_54delCT | Ser18Trpfs | Homozygous | No[ | Yes | [ |
| c.131T >C | Ile44Thr | Homozygous | Yes | Yes | [ |
| c.149delG | Arg50Lysfs | Homozygous | Yes | Yes | [ |
| c.239G >C | Arg80Thr Arg184 | Compound heterozygous | Yes | Yes | [ |
| c.240-2A >C | Splice site | Homozygous | Yes | Yes | [ |
| c.352C >T | Gln118 | Compound heterozygous | Yes | Yes | [ |
| c.550C >T | Arg184 | Homozygous | Yes | Yes | [ |
| c.244C >T | Arg82Cys | Homozygous | Yes | ∆[ | [ |
| c.343+2T >C | Splice site | Compound heterozygous | Yes | Yes | This study |
*Hemophagocytosis was identified by liver biopsy; †The patient presented with cytopenia and immunological abnormalities but showed no evidence of hemophagocytosis in bone marrow biopsy; ‡Phenotypic heterogeneity was observed in multiple families with the same homozygous missense variant from asymptomatic cases to the typical clinical presentation of GS2.
Abbreviations: HLH, hemophagocytic lymphohistiocytosis; GS2, Griscelli syndrome type 2.
